Origins

The surname 'Bizkai' is derived from the Basque word 'Bizkaia', which is the name of a province in northern Spain. The Basque people are known for their distinct language and culture, and the surname 'Bizkai' is a reflection of this heritage. It is believed that the surname originated as a geographical identifier, indicating that the bearer was from or had ancestral ties to the region of Bizkaia. Over time, this surname became hereditary and passed down through generations.

Distribution

According to data collected from Spain, the surname 'Bizkai' has an incidence of 26 in the country. This data indicates that there are a relatively small number of individuals with the surname 'Bizkai' in Spain. The surname is most likely concentrated in the Basque region, particularly in areas with historical ties to the province of Bizkaia. It is not widely distributed outside of Spain, as the surname is specific to the Basque language and culture.
